Description:
In Impress or Draw, when clicking within a Text Box, the text (individual
characters) moves slightly in the horizontal or vertical direction (not always
the same).
This does not affect the final rendering of the text but it is a bit strange.
The text must stay at the same place when clicking in a Text Box, whatever the
zooming factor.
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Open the attached impress_example.odp
2. Click somewhere on the text, the cursor is within a Text Box and the text
has moved slightly (some characters move, some not and this seems to depend on
the zooming factor)
3. Click outside the Text Box, the text moves back to its original position.
You can repeat 2. and 3. to see the text move at each click.
You can see the same behaviour in Draw by opening the attached file
draw_example.odg.
Actual Results:
Expected Results:
The text should not move at all when clicking within a Text Box, whatever the
zooming factor.
Reproducible: Always
